It's been five years since Breaking Bad finished, and it looks like we aren't the only ones who are missing the show.

Jesse and Walt - aka actors Aaron Paul and Bryan Cranston - have invited fans via a Facebook video to come along and cook in the famous RV with them at Sony Studios in LA in a competition to celebrate the tenth anniversary of the show's premiere.

Ok, they're cooking breakfast rather than meth, but that's probably for the best, eh?

One winner and a friend will be flown out to LA and put up in a four-star hotel before spending some time with the Hollywood heroes in the RV.

It's part of a charity fundraiser in partnership with Omaze in support of the Kind Campaign, which raises awareness of girl-against-girl bullying, and the National Center for Missing and Exploited Children in the US.

The Facebook video shows Aaron talking about the competition and the cracking prize before taking viewers on a 'tour' of the RV.

Which is where he finds Bryan, squatting in the RV in a dressing gown having apparently been living there (hey, I'll willingly suspend my disbelief for this cause), eating from a hot plate and using a bucket as a toilet (umm... ok, too much).

He eventually breaks down and confides in Aaron that he misses the show and desperately wants it to be rebooted, but Aaron shoots him down and tells him the show is over and that he needs to move on.

But as it turns out, Aaron hasn't moved on at all and has been working as a tour guide for Sony Studios just so he can be around the RV again.

And they want you to visit - with Bryan adding: "We'll let you touch our Emmys."
